CVE-2017-15815 : What You Need to Know

Learn about CVE-2017-15815, a buffer overflow vulnerability affecting Android for MSM, Firefox OS for MSM, QRD Android, and all Android releases from CAF, potentially leading to arbitrary code execution or denial of service.

Android for MSM, Firefox OS for MSM, QRD Android, and all Android releases from CAF may be vulnerable to a buffer overflow when processing 802.11 MGMT frames.

Understanding CVE-2017-15815

This CVE involves a potential buffer overflow in various software systems that utilize the Linux kernel, specifically during the processing of 802.11 MGMT frames.

What is CVE-2017-15815?

A buffer overflow vulnerability that can occur in Android for MSM, Firefox OS for MSM, QRD Android, and all Android releases from CAF when handling 802.11 MGMT frames, particularly during the processing of the Auth frame within the limProcessAuthFrame function.

The Impact of CVE-2017-15815

The vulnerability could be exploited by attackers to execute arbitrary code or cause a denial of service (DoS) condition on affected systems.

Technical Details of CVE-2017-15815

This section provides more in-depth technical insights into the CVE.

Vulnerability Description

The vulnerability arises due to a buffer overflow issue in the processing of 802.11 MGMT frames, specifically within the Auth frame in the limProcessAuthFrame function.

Affected Systems and Versions

        Android for MSM
        Firefox OS for MSM
        QRD Android
        All Android releases from CAF

Exploitation Mechanism

Attackers can exploit this vulnerability by crafting malicious 802.11 MGMT frames, triggering the buffer overflow and potentially executing arbitrary code.
